  2. I didn't see a great deal of difference going from 9 to X...I saw the biggest growth from 7/8 to 9. The major thing for me was needing to use the newer icons and using the mill got those in my head. I needed the big icons for a long time while learning the X style Bars. That graphical difference shouldn't hurt too bad if they can learn to find their old commands. Right clicking in the Manager area can give them the named commands if they don't like using the icons for Ops.
